A good way to avoid hemorrhoids from forming is to eat plenty of fiber. Include foods that contain plenty of fiber, such as whole-grain breads, leafy greens, wheat pasta and oatmeal. Fiber promotes healthy and regular movement of the bowels, which also reduces strain.

Hemorrhoids are often aggravated by difficult bowel movements and the resulting strains they put on the excretory system. Stools will move more freely if you absorb large quantities of water and maintain a diet that is low in refined foods. Squatting is one way you can help pass a bowel movement without straining. As you sit on your toilet, put a small stool beneath your feet. This squatting position has proven to help pass stools with less stress on the body, and this can be seen in areas around the world where cultures who squat simply do not have the issues with hemorrhoids that the people of the Western world have.

Weight loss can help alleviate pain caused by hemorrhoids. Being too heavy can exacerbate the effects of hemorrhoids. Abdominal pressure from extra weight can cause tension in your anal veins. Lose weight by following a high fiber diet, and you will alleviate the pressure on these areas of the body. However, you shouldn’t take laxatives on a regular basis to help you lose weight. This type of weight loss plan is unhealthy. Don’t take laxatives regularly to treat hemorrhoids, either; see your doctor if hemorrhoids continue to bother you or your stool continues to be too hard.
